How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Crotona Park East?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Crotona Park East 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,014 | $2,000 | $2,028 |
| Crotona Park East 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,833 | $2,700 | $3,000 |
| Crotona Park East 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,684 | $3,500 | $3,900 |
| Crotona Park East 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,061 | $1,400 | $3,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Crotona Park East
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Crotona Park East c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Crotona Park East range from $2,700 to $3,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,833.
